Cleaning and Storage
Service Interval : Before storage
Before storage
1. P ark the mac hine on a lev el surface , diseng ag e
the PTO , and mo v e the motion-control lev ers
outw ard to the P ark position.
2. Shut off the mac hine , remo v e the k ey , and w ait
for all mo ving par ts to stop before lea ving the
operating position.
3. R emo v e g rass clippings , dir t, and g rime from
the exter nal par ts of the entire mac hine using
compressed air .
Important: Do not use w ater to clean the
machine, otherwise y ou could dama ge the
motor s and other electric components.
4. Chec k the brak e; refer to P ar k P osition ( pag e 15 ) .
5. Grease the mac hine; refer to
Gr easing the Machine ( pag e 37 ) .
6. Chec k the tire pressure; refer to
Checking the Tir e Pr essur e ( pag e 40 ) .
7. Chec k and tighten all fasteners . R e pair or re place
any par t that is damag ed or missing .
8. P aint all scratc hed or bare metal surfaces with
paint from an A uthorized Ser vice Dealer .
9. Store the mac hine in a clean, dr y , g arag e or
storag e area. R emo v e the k ey from the switc h and
store it in a memorable place . Co v er the mac hine
to protect it and k ee p it clean.
10. F or prolong ed storag e , follo w the batter y storag e
requirements; refer to ( pag e ) .
Battery Storage
Requirements
Note: Y ou do not need to remo v e the batteries from
the mac hine for storag e .
R efer to the temperature limits for storag e in the
follo wing table:
T emperature Limits for Storage
Stora ge T emperatur e
Appr opriate Stora ge
Time
45° to 55°C (113° to
131°F)
1 w eek
25° to 45°C (77° to 113°F)
3 w eeks
-20° to 25°C (-4° to 77°F)
52 w eeks
Important: T emperatur es outside of these
ranges will dama ge y our batteries.
T he temperatur e that the batteries ar e stor ed
at will af fect their long-ter m life. Stora ge f or
long periods of time at extr eme temperatur es
will r educe the batter y life. F or temperatur es
a bo v e 25°C (77°F), onl y stor e the machine f or
the appr opriate amount of time indicated in the
ta ble.
• Before y ou store the mac hine , c harg e or disc harg e
the batteries betw een 40% to 60% (54.3V to
57.3V).
Note: A 50% c harg e is optimal to ensure a
maxim um batter y life . W hen the batteries are
c harg ed to 100% before storag e , the batter y life
shor tens .
If y ou anticipate that the mac hine will be stored
for a long er period of time , c harg e the batteries to
around 60%.
• F or ev er y 6 months of storag e , c hec k the
batter y-c harg e lev el and ensure that it is betw een
40% to 60%. If the c harg e is belo w 40%, c harg e
the batteries betw een 40% to 60%.
